The largest irrigation canal in India is |
A. | Yarnuna canal |
B. | Indira Gandhi canal |
C. | Sirhand canal |
D. | Upper Bari Doab canal |
Answer» B. Indira Gandhi canal | |
Explanation: The Indira Gandhi Canal is the largest irrigation project India. It starts from the Harike Barrage at Firozpur, below the confluence of the Satluj and Beas rivers in the Indian state of Punjab and terminates in irrigation facilities in the Thar Desert in Rajasthan. It runs through Punjab, Haiyana and Rajasthan. |
